Well, the 'pilgrim's progress graphic novel' has a great significance. For one, it helps to preserve the story for a new generation. The use of graphics can enhance the understanding of the complex themes in the original work. It also has the potential to reach a wider international audience as the visual medium is more universal in some ways.

The hybrid graphic novel is significant as it combines the best of both worlds. It blends the visual allure of graphic art with the in - depth storytelling of traditional novels. This form can attract a wider range of readers, including those who are more visually inclined and those who love complex narratives.
Knives is an important character in the Scott Pilgrim graphic novel. She is one of Scott's love interests. Her presence adds complexity to the story's love triangle and also represents a certain naivete and youthful energy compared to the other characters.
